page 1Submarine topography
oceanic trench
depressions of the sea floor
abyssal plain
flat area on the ocean floor
submarine volcano
underwater vents or fissures in the Earth's surface from which magma can erupt
oceanic plateau
relatively flat submarine region that rises well above the level of the ambient seabed
carbonate platform
sedimentary body with topographic relief composed of autochthonous calcareous deposits
undersea mountain range
mountain ranges that are mostly or entirely under the surface of an ocean.
